  About the Chamber   

Mission:
The Brooklyn Chamber of Commerce is a community of Members that supports and advocates for its Member businesses, and promotes a healthy and robust business environment in Brooklyn. 

Vision:
The Brooklyn Chamber of Commerce will be the foremost resource for doing business in Brooklyn, respected locally and beyond as a leader in advancing public policy, new technologies, products, services and programs that support and promote a vibrant local economy.

About the Chamber:
Founded in 1918, the Brooklyn Chamber of Commerce is a business assistance and economic development organization dedicated to helping businesses grow and to promoting the economic development of Brooklyn.
 
The Brooklyn Chamber has over 1,500 Members, including local, regional and national businesses with customers or business interests in neighborhoods across the borough.  The Chamber's membership mirrors the Brooklyn business community. From proprietors to large corporations, Member businesses represent industries such as financial services, energy, insurance, manufacturing, dining, shopping, wholesale and retail trade, fashion, hospitality, health care, real estate and communications.

The Brooklyn Chamber provides a wide range of promotional, support and advocacy services to assist its Members, attract new investment to the borough and improve local business conditions. 

PromotionThe Brooklyn Chamber of Commerce connects its Members to new customers in Brooklyn and beyond through a packed schedule of networking events, trade shows, business expos and committee activities.  Members are given numerous opportunities to promote their businesses through Brooklyn Chamber communications vehicles, including the Chamber’s newspaper Brooklyn’s Progress, Member-to-Member mailings, the annual Brooklyn Business Directory & Buying Guide and the Chamber’s award-winning Web site, ibrooklyn.com.

AdvocacyDescribed by Crain’s New York Business as “an activist champion of small business,” the Brooklyn Chamber of Commerce manages an aggressive advocacy program combining research, surveys, government relations and communications.  The Brooklyn Chamber, through its Board of Directors and Government Affairs Committee, has forged key relationships with elected officials and leaders of government agencies, making it a forceful advocate for the business community and helping it to secure major investments for the economic and community development of Brooklyn.
